What is a Globe Valve and Why Choose a Specialized Manufacturer?
A globe valve is a type of valve used for regulating flow. It features a spherical body with an internal baffle, providing excellent throttling capabilities. Unlike other valve types, globe valves are designed for frequent operation, making them ideal for applications requiring precise flow control. Globe Valve Types: Matching the Valve to Your Application
Different globe valve designs cater to specific application needs. Common types include straight-pattern, angle-pattern, and Y-pattern globe valves. Straight-pattern valves offer minimal flow resistance but require more space. Angle-pattern valves provide a 90-degree turn, simplifying piping layouts. Y-pattern valves feature a streamlined flow path, reducing pressure drop. The choice depends on factors like space constraints, desired flow characteristics, and maintenance accessibility. What materials are commonly used in globe valve construction?
Globe valves are constructed from a variety of materials depending on the application’s requirements. Carbon steel is a common choice for general-purpose applications due to its strength and cost-effectiveness. Stainless steel is preferred for corrosive environments, offering excellent resistance to chemicals and oxidation. Alloy steels are used in high-temperature and high-pressure applications. How often should globe valves be inspected?
Regular inspection is critical for maintaining the reliability of globe valves. Recommended inspection frequency depends on the application and operating conditions, but at least annual inspections are advisable. Inspections should include visual checks for leaks, corrosion, and damage to the valve body, stem, and seat. Also, verify the proper functioning of the valve actuator and associated components. What are the key benefits of choosing a globe valve over other valve types?
Globe valves excel in applications requiring precise flow control and frequent operation. Their throttling capabilities are superior to many other valve types, allowing for accurate regulation of fluid flow. They also provide tight shut-off, minimizing leakage. While they offer slightly higher pressure drop than some valve designs, the benefits of accurate control and reliability often outweigh this disadvantage, especially in critical applications. What is the role of a valve actuator?
A valve actuator is the mechanism responsible for opening and closing the globe valve. Actuators can be manual (handwheel), pneumatic (air-operated), electric, or hydraulic. The choice of actuator depends on factors such as the required force, speed, and control system integration.
